Where Did These Bingo Calls Come From?

The history is a bit fuzzy. Some say they came from British Army rhyming slang. Others say they were invented by bingo hall callers to keep the players entertained during long sessions. I think it is a mix of everything. The classic calls are deeply British. ‘Doctor’s Orders’ for 9. ‘Unlucky for Some’ for 13. They are cultural touchstones. They are a shared joke between the caller and the room.

Here is a quick list of some of my absolute favourites that you will still hear today:

  • 9: Doctor’s Orders (Doctor Who? Doctor’s Orders!)
  • 11: Legs Eleven (Very popular for obvious reasons)
  • 22: Two Little Ducks (Quack quack!)
  • 55: All the Fives (or Snakes Alive)
  • 66: Clickety Click (Just sounds satisfying)
  • 88: Two Fat Ladies (Always gets a chuckle)
  • 90: Top of the Shop (The big one)

Modern Bingo Number Sayings and Fresh Variations

Now, not everyone sticks to the old book. A good caller will invent new ones. I have heard ‘Michael Jackson’ for 25 (because of ‘Billie Jean’). I have heard ‘Easter Sunday’ for 17 (I am not sure why, but it works). The game evolves. The online bingo sites at places like 888 Ladies or Gala Bingo often have chat rooms where players create their own nicknames for numbers. It keeps things fresh.

Some rooms even have ‘themed’ bingo. You get a festive game where all the calls are Christmas related. ‘Three Wise Men’ for 3. ‘Rudolph’s Nose’ for 1. It is silly. But it is fun.
